Ranking the 9 Strongest Final Fantasy Ultimate Weapons

An element that makes the Final Fantasy (FF) installments different from one another is their weapons. Among the many, many types, the most special is the ultimate weapons. These are unique single-weapon models specially built as the best versions of their respective games. 

 

Yet the more important matter here is, while some are extremely powerful and useful, others are just simply a bummer. Here are some of the nine strongest FF ultimate weapons.

Also known as Illumina, this is a weapon immersed with the Holy element. Hence, it has the power to quickly execute the undead. It appeared several times in different FF installments, notably as a ranged weapon in FF IV and VI.

 

Masamune

Massively huge and the original ultimate weapon of the FF franchise, Masamune is one of the most popular and powerful katanas available to any type of character. If it helps to decide whether it’s worth it, keep in mind that it’s wielded by Sephiroth.

 

Ragnarok

A.K.A. the Crystal Sword, Ragnarok is an epitome of a knight or holy sword. It’s so powerful and manifested that it contrastingly matches dark swords from Norse and Germanic origins.

 

Save the Queen

Save the Queen is a debatable powerful sword because it differs by several types. What’s proven, however, is that it’s efficiently powerful for female characters or Paladins (i.e. Beatrice choosing it as her choice of weapon).

 

Excalibur

One of the most popular legendary swords in the Matter of Britain, Excalibur is now among the strongest recurring weapons featured in almost all FF installments. Like Lightbringer, it’s often linked to the Holy element, which also explains why it has a cheap artificial version: Excalipoor.

 

Ultima Weapon

Weapons become famous because of iconic characters, and the Ultima Weapon is highly best known as the main weapon of Cloud Strife. It’s so versatile that it sometimes appears as a dual blade, gun, or gunblade. Best of all, it challenges every player to take the game to greater heights. If the user’s health points (HP) increases, the sharper the weapon’s blade becomes.

 

Apocalypse 

The Apocalypse is a well-balanced recurring weapon throughout the series. Among all of its handlers, it was really the wise choice for Terra. 

 

Tournesol 

With its special design, background, and power, it’s no wonder it appeals to almost all gamers. The golden sword with runes carved on the blade is the ultimate greatsword for any type of game in the series. 

 

Buster Sword

The Buster Sword is an iconic weapon because, after all, it appears in one of the best FF RPG games: FF VII. Like Tournesol, the five to six feet long sword holds so much story and power. It belonged to the late Zack Fair, who then passed it down to Cloud.
